    This theory has been formulated byDouglas McGregor.Employees can view work as being as natural as rest or play.

    People will exercise self-direction and self-control if they arecommitted to the objectives.

    The average person can learn to accept, even seek, responsibility.

    The ability to make innovative decisions is widely dispersedthroughout the population and is not necessarily the sole provinceof those in management positions.

    McClelland eorMcClellendswork focussed on research that sugested what

    motivates people (which they learn from earlychildhood) is thatlife experiences and behaviour will determine the individual

    needs. He classified his these needs as Achievement, Affiliation& Power.

    y Achievement - The drive to excel, to achieve a set of standards, tostrive to succeed.

    y Affiliation Workers will perform best in co-operative workingenvironment with the opportunity to share ideas.

    y Power The need to make others behave in a way that they would nothave behaved otherwise.

    The Case study has been done on a visit by doing the ITC Office. On guidance ofMr. NitishShah (Associate Manager) of ITC Ltd. India.

    There were several measures stated by him which keeps MOTIVATION ENHANCEMENTfor the employees.

    ITC grants a holiday for all his employees for free of cost once ayear at TAJ, to keep them happy.

    There are several other benefits granted, such as Loans, PF, ITCSmart Card, Free Travel Card, etc.

    ITC also provides benefits for the families of the employees, asthat would keep surroundings around managers happy and resultinto efficient work.

    ITC conducts special meetings to interact with employees, evenworking at the lowermost post of the Company.

    ITC grants them rewards on the exceptional performance of theemployees.
